Mastering Readability and Usage
While Wild Youth is stunning, it is important to understand where it fits best within your design hierarchy. Because it is a flowing script font, it excels as a headline, a logo mark, or for short phrases. It is not typically designed for long paragraphs of body text, especially on small screens or tiny labels where legibility is key.
When designing for mobile devices or social media thumbnails, keep the size large enough to ensure the strokes remain clear. On printed packaging, such as a small candle sticker, use it for the main title and pair it with a simpler font for ingredients or instructions. This balance ensures your design remains professional and customer-friendly without sacrificing style. Remember, readability affects user experience; if a customer has to squint to read your offer, you've lost them.
Perfect Pairings for a Polished Look
To get the most out of Wild Youth, consider how it interacts with other typefaces. The secret to modern typography often lies in contrast. Since Wild Youth is organic and fluid, it pairs exceptionally well with clean, structured fonts.
A safe and effective choice is a neutral sans serif font for your body copy. The geometric simplicity of a sans serif allows the elegance of the script to take center stage without creating visual clutter. Alternatively, a classic serif font can add a layer of traditional authority, making your brand feel established and trustworthy. Avoid pairing it with other heavy script or handwritten fonts, as this can create a chaotic look that undermines your professional image. The goal is a cohesive brand identity where every element supports the others.

Most importantly, verify the commercial font licensing. Using a font for personal projects is one thing, but applying it to products you sell—like merchandise, templates, or client work—requires a proper license. Ensuring you have the rights to use Wild Youth commercially protects you from legal issues and gives you peace of mind as you scale your business. Always check the terms regarding web usage, app integration, and print runs to stay compliant.
